The Geneva to Orange distance is approximately 252 km.
The average frequency per day from Geneva to Orange is:
  • Around 41 flights per day.
  • Around 6 coaches per day.
  • Around 6 trains per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Geneva and Orange as scheduled services by coach, train and flight can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Geneva to Orange:
  • Coaches mostly depart from Geneve, Place Dorcière and arrive in Le Pontet, Avignon Gare de Bus (Ave. Charles de Gaulle).
  • Flights mostly depart from Geneva International Airport and arrive in Marseille Provence Airport.
  • Trains mostly depart from Geneva station and arrive in Orange station.
